Nick Mastrascusa was among the six people who died Sunday when a small plane registered to the same address as a Houston law firm crashed in Maine, his family said in a verified GoFundMe.
“Nick touched the lives of so many in our community through his kindness, dedication, generosity and friendship,” reads the GoFundMe, which states Mastrascusa was married and had three children.
Four passengers and two crew members were aboard the plane that crashed during takeoff from Bangor International Airport, according to officials, who said that all were presumed to be dead by authorities. The plane’s address was registered to the address of Houston personal injury law firm Arnold & Ipkin, FAA records show…
